J.W. Hill, chief operating officer at the National Council for Prescription Drug Programs and executive director of the NCPDP Foundation, tells this week’s Video Forum about the organization’s ongoing work with the Office of the National Coordinator for Health Information Technology to support interoperability of patient data. He offers insights on some of the ONC’s top priorities and their relevance to retail pharmacies.
